在当今信息高度互联的时代,隐私保护和网络安全变得愈发重要,无论是远程办公、访问受限内容,还是绕过地域限制,一个稳定、安全且可控的虚拟私人网络(VPN)已成为许多用户的刚需,而使用VPS(虚拟专用服务器)搭建个人VPN,不仅成本低廉,而且具有极高的灵活性与自主权,本文将详细介绍如何利用VPS搭建一个基于OpenVPN或WireGuard协议的个人VPN服务,帮助你实现真正的网络自由。
第一步:选择合适的VPS服务商
你需要租用一台性能稳定的VPS,推荐选择如DigitalOcean、Linode或AWS Lightsail等国际主流平台,它们提供按小时计费、易于管理的云服务器,建议配置至少1核CPU、1GB内存、20GB硬盘空间,带宽不限或高带宽套餐,以保证流畅的连接体验。
第二步:部署操作系统与基础环境
登录你的VPS后,通常会默认安装Ubuntu 20.04 LTS或Debian 11,通过SSH连接后,先更新系统:
sudo apt update && sudo apt upgrade -y
接着安装必要的工具包,例如ufw防火墙、fail2ban防暴力破解,以及nano或vim编辑器,方便后续配置。
第三步:安装并配置OpenVPN(或WireGuard)
OpenVPN是成熟稳定的开源方案,适合初学者;而WireGuard则更轻量高效,适合对速度敏感的用户,以OpenVPN为例,可通过官方脚本一键部署:
wget https://git.io/vpnsetup -O vpnsetup.sh chmod +x vpnsetup.sh sudo ./vpnsetup.sh
脚本会自动配置证书、端口转发、IP转发,并生成客户端配置文件,完成后,你可以用手机或电脑导入.ovpn文件连接。
第四步:安全加固与优化
- 启用UFW防火墙,仅开放SSH(22)、OpenVPN端口(如1194);
- 修改SSH默认端口,禁用root登录;
- 使用fail2ban防止暴力破解;
- 定期备份证书和配置文件,避免数据丢失;
- 可选:启用DNS加密(如DoH/DoT)增强隐私。
第五步:测试与维护
连接成功后,验证IP是否隐藏(访问ipinfo.io),并检查延迟和带宽,建议定期更新软件包,监控日志(journalctl -u openvpn),及时处理异常连接。
用VPS搭建个人VPN,不仅提升了网络安全性,还让你摆脱了商业服务的限制和审查,它是一种技术赋能下的数字主权实践,虽然过程略显复杂,但一旦掌握,你将获得前所未有的网络自由——无论身处何地,都能安心上网,畅享全球资源,对于追求隐私与控制力的用户来说,这是一条值得投入的技术之路。

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速









